Tire rotation is performed to prevent uneven wear, and that’s extremely important for tire longevity. While it may sound like your wheels are simply moving as-intended, a tire rotation is when tires are removed and reinstalled under another wheel well.
Because most engines are located in the front, cars usually carry more weight at the front. Front tires also do the steering, and many cars today are front-wheel drive. That means front tires typically wear out faster than rear tires. In most cases, the front tires will move to the rear and the rear tires will move to the front. In many cases, they may also flip sides so what was the rear left tire end up being the front right tire.
